ICERAYS COMPLETE SWEEP 3-0

Jan 12, 2012

CORPUS CHRISTI, TX – Zachary Lindsay scored twice in the third period, and Anthony Stolarz stopped all 40 shots he faced as the IceRays completed the series sweep over the Odessa Jackalopes 3-0 in front of 2,904 fans inside the American Bank Center.

Just like last night’s game, there was no scoring in the first period.

Beau Walker took a one timer off an AJ Jarosz pass and beat Odessa goaltender Connor Hellebuyck on the power-play 7:33 into the second period to give the IceRays a 1-0 lead after 40 minutes of play.

The third period started off the right way for Corpus Christi as Zachary Lindsay scored just 0:14 seconds into the period increasing the lead for the IceRays 2-0.

Lindsay struck again for his second goal of the game 14:17 into the final period of action to give the IceRays a 3-0 lead. 

Anthony Stolarz was brilliant tonight as he stopped all 40 shots he faced from the Jackalopes.
